Meeker announces summer meal distribution at library; town discusses cemetery and lake mowing
Summary
Mayor Weber said the library will again distribute free meal boxes for children 18 and under starting June 8; Town Administrator Jeff Wilbourn described mowing plans for cemetery and lake and requested direction on compensation for using his larger equipment.

Mayor Donna Weber told the Board the library will coordinate distribution of free meal boxes for children 18 and under beginning June 8, 2026, from 5: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. at the Fire Station, continuing a similar program from the prior year. Town Administrator Jeff Wilbourn reported the Town plans to mow cemetery areas before Memorial Day and discussed maintenance at the Town lake. Wilbourn said he has used his personal tractor and equipment for mowing in past years and estimated mowing the lake with larger equipment would cost about $1,000 and take about six hours. He asked the Board whether that work should be handled as contracted work or under his regular hourly pay; a member of the public suggested opening the work to bids for transparency. Wilbourn said the anticipated cost did not meet the formal bidding threshold but requested direction before performing the work.
